Divine Mercy Daily Reflections from the Diary of Saint Maria Faustina Kowalska Friday, December 18 Conversations with the Merciful Savior Part Two: With a Soul Striving after Perfection Jesus: My child, know that the greatest obstacles to holiness are discouragement and an exaggerated anxiety. These will deprive you of the ability to practice virtue. All temptations united together ought not disturb your interior peace, not even momentarily. Sensitiveness and discouragement are the fruits of self-love. You should not become discouraged, but strive to make My love reign in place of your self-love. Have confidence, My child. Do not lose heart in coming for pardon, for I am always ready to forgive you. As often as you beg for it, you glorify My mercy (Diary, 1488). My Prayer Response: Lord Jesus, You certainly put Your finger on my problem — exaggerated anxiety. Help me to make Your love reign in place of my self-love. Help me with Your mercy.
